Primary Purpose of the Organizational Unit

The ITS Enterprise Technology Infrastructure team manages the organization’s network, communication systems, IT facilities, research infrastructure, enterprise systems, and data infrastructure to ensure robust, secure, and high‑performance IT operations. This department supports critical technological functions across the enterprise, enabling seamless connectivity, advanced research capabilities, and efficient data management.

Position Summary

The primary purpose of this position is to architect, manage, and maintain high- performance/high-availability information transport systems infrastructure that supports enterprise technology services:

  • Provides cabling/wiring services for UNCG’s Layer 1 network/communications infrastructure.
  • Designs, manages, and installs Commscope and Corning cabling systems in accordance with University design guidelines and standards.
  • Ensures the timely repair of UNCG’s inside cable plant and outside cable plant.
  • Collaborates with other ITS teams, the UNCG Facilities department, Designers, and Contractors to ensure UNCG’s structured cabling systems are properly designed, built, and protected during construction and renovation projects.

Key Responsibilities Fiber Infrastructure

Percentage Of Time: 20%

  • Provide operational oversight and manage the campus fiber optic infrastructure, including duct bank, fiber optic backbone, and building tie‑ins.
  • Maintain records of fiber infrastructure, including allocations and usage.
  • Respond to calls on the UNCG Fiber Identification Line and provide emergency response to fiber violations.
  • Maintain and manage agreements with UNCG departments and external entities, as appropriate, to provide request fulfillment, emergency break/fix, and outside plant locate services.
Network Wiring

Percentage Of Time: 20%

  • Manage the University’s inside cable plant, providing operational oversight in the implementation and management of Layer 1 communications infrastructure for data center, building distribution, and telecom facilities that enable network connectivity.
  • Design, develop, and document processes and procedures required to operate and maintain network wiring, including horizontal and vertical cabling.
  • Design and manage University telecommunications standards and ensure publication as needed.
Layer 1 Communications Infrastructure

Percentage Of Time: 20%

  • Lead and manage request fulfillment for moves, adds, and changes to Layer 1 communications infrastructure.
